Old Friend, New Look – Introduction to AppliChem IPEC-Grade Products

IPEC (International Pharmaceutical Excipients Council) is a global non-profit industry organization composed of five major regional associations worldwide: IPEC US, IPEC Europe, IPEC Japan, IPEC China, and IPEC India. It is committed to developing quality, safety, and management standards for pharmaceutical excipients. Products of IPEC grade generally refer to pharmaceutical excipients that comply with the IPEC-PQG GMP Guidelines or other IPEC standards, ensuring their applicability and safety in the pharmaceutical industry.

Excipients of IPEC grade must comply with the following core standards:

 

(1) GMP Compliance

· Production meets the IPEC-PQG GMP Guidelines (or equivalent standards)

· Ensure that the production environment, equipment, processes, and document management comply with GMP requirements

 

(2) Safety Assessment

· Comply with IPEC safety assessment guidelines to ensure the safety of excipients in pharmaceuticals

· Provide toxicological data (e.g., ICH-Q3D elemental impurity control)

 

(3) Supply Chain Traceability

· Comply with IPEC GDP (Good Distribution Practice) to ensure that transportation and storage meet requirements

· Provide complete batch records and Certificate of Analysis (COA)

 

(4) Pharmacopoeia Compliance

· Comply with pharmacopoeial standards such as USP/EP/JP/ChP (e.g., microbial limits, heavy metals, residual solvents, etc.)

 

Therefore, IPEC-grade products have the following advantages:

 

Advantage

Description

High quality standard

Complies with international GMP and pharmacopoeial requirements, Ensures stable quality of excipients

Safety Assurance

 

After strict safety assessment, the risk of pharmaceuticals is reduced.

Reliable Supply Chain

Complies with GDP standards to ensure compliance in transportation and storage

Global Recognition

 

Suitable for regulatory markets such as the FDA, EMA, and NMPA

Reduce approval barriers

Pharmaceutical companies can pass regulatory audits more easily.

 

 

IPEC-grade pharmaceutical excipients are high-standard products in the pharmaceutical industry, complying with international GMP, safety assessment, and supply chain management requirements.
